The main aim of this study is to determine the problems experienced by the foreign students who study at Karamanoglu Mehmetbey University and in Karaman Province, and to develop solution strategies for them. Within the scope of the study, firstly the conceptual framework related to the topic has been discussed and a field research has been conducted for the foreign students studying at University.
